    : Ray was very helpful in realizing our dream extensions. Our project included building a two story additions. A new family room and a new master bedroom including master bathroom. All other architects were out of our price range. We were glad to find Ray because we could afford him. He didn't use a computer rendering of what our project would look like so we were limited to reading the blueprints. At first Ray made blueprints of the new extension with a 3 foot offset from the property line because it was against the ordinance to build new structures less than 6 ft. We had an existing exterior wall 3 feet from the property line. This is where I made a mistake to not question Ray. Ray's advice was to stay away from filing for variances. I let him continue with writing up the blueprints. I submitted the plans to the building department for approvals. It took months and while I was waiting, I called the town and asked them about the 3 foot offset. Remember, I had a existing pre-ordinance wall already there. Why couldn't I just extend that wall ? They said to me "that's a question your architect should be asking us". They wouldn't answer my question so I had to call Ray to calol them to get an answer. This delayed getting the permits another month. When he finally got the answer, it was "yes" we could just extend the existing wall without filing a variance. Ray had to draw up new plans and resubmit the plans and then the town rejected his plans. This was extremely frustration to us because it had nothing to do with the extension. It was about minor details. So that took another month. Again, Ray had to resubmit plans. Through all this Ray was very gracious and apologized to us but it wasn't all his fault. Overall he is a good architect but you have to question him more. If you're not happy with his plans, he will do whatever possible to satisfy you.

    What is the screening process that Service Professionals go through in order to become members of the HomeAdvisor network?

    1. Verify Trade License
      HomeAdvisor checks to see if the business carries the appropriate state-level license.
    2. Verify Insurance
      As a part of our screening process, we encourage professionals to carry general liability insurance. We require coverage for hundreds of services.
    3. Verification of State Business Filings
      For business types that require a Secretary of State filing, we confirm that the business is in good standing in the state in which it is located.
    4. Criminal Records Search
      HomeAdvisor uses 3rd party data sources to conduct a criminal search for any relevant criminal activity associated with the owner/principal of the business.
    5. Sex Offender Search
      We confirm that the owner/principal is not listed on the official state Sex Offender web site in the state in which the owner/principal of the company is located.
    6. Bankruptcy Search
      We use 3rd party data sources to check the history of the principal/owner of the business for bankruptcy filings by or against them.
    7. Legal Search for Civil Judgments
      We use 3rd party data sources to check the principal/owner of the business for state level civil legal judgments entered against them.
    8. Liens Search
      We use 3rd party data sources to check the principal/owner of the business for liens placed against them.
    9. Identity Verification (SSN)
      HomeAdvisor verifies the social security number(s) of the owner/principal for identity check purposes. This check applies primarily to smaller business entities.
    10. Identity Verification (Reverse Phone Lookup)
      We conduct a reverse business phone lookup to identify records matching the phone number information provided by the business.
